Barclays Names Hiroshi Minoura Chairman of Investment Banking in Japan

Barclays plc has announced several new management changes in its Asia Pacific operations. Hiroshi Minoura has been appointed Chairman of Investment Banking in Japan. Recent appointments also include Jean-François Mastrangelo as Head of Markets, Asia Pacific; Neel Laungani as Head of Financial Sponsors, Asia Pacific; Joseph Lee as Head of High Touch Sales Trading, Asia Pacific; Yoichi Takemura as Head of Japan Macro Trading; and Paul Johnson as Head of Equities, Asia Pacific. Barclays has also made key leadership appointments in its Asia Pacific Investment Banking division and strengthened its Corporate Bank offerings in the region.
